Output 3ed345195b514edee531f4f951e7582c86e7c6c03f781fd64bc8eaeb40347d5e:1

value
159198631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ad18eb0c101c4b7d671546f8a7001e22f882c458 OP_EQUAL
address
3HUGg5FH869AspwMjufJHGCB3VVszDkNqb
transaction
3ed345195b514edee531f4f951e7582c86e7c6c03f781fd64bc8eaeb40347d5e
spent
true